On 2014-07-09 the FDA classified a Class II recall of Brevibloc Premixed Injection, Esmolol Hydrochloride in Sodium Chloride, 2,500 mg/250 mL (10 mg/mL), 250 mL Single Use IntraVia container, p… by Baxter Healthcare, citing presence of Particulate Matter: Complaints received of discolored solution identified as subvisible particles of iron oxide that are agglomerating.

Product
Brevibloc Premixed Injection, Esmolol Hydrochloride in Sodium Chloride, 2,500 mg/250 mL (10 mg/mL), 250 mL Single Use IntraVia container, packaged in 10 x 250 mL Single Use IntraVia containers per carton, Rx only, Baxter Healthcare Corporation, Deerfield, IL 60015 USA, Product Code 2J1415, NDC 10019-055-61.
Reason
Presence of Particulate Matter: Complaints received of discolored solution identified as subvisible particles of iron oxide that are agglomerating.
